Eray Cinpir
Eray Cinpir was born in Bursa, Türkiye. His musical journey began with the ney and continued at the Dilek Sabancı State Conservatory of Selçuk University in Konya. In 2013, he joined the Konya Turkish Sufi Music Ensemble of the Ministry of Culture and Tourism as a vocalist and won first place in an international vocal competition the same year. After completing his master’s degree at Gazi University, he began his doctoral studies in Ethnomusicology at Mimar Sinan Fine Arts University. During this period, he also taught vocal performance and repertoire at various state conservatories. He has appeared in over a hundred programs on TRT channels as a vocalist, ney player, and presenter. Representing Turkish music on international stages, he has performed concerts and conducted workshops in more than twenty countries. Having also served as a project coordinator in several ministry productions, he has taken part in numerous traditional Turkish music albums. He currently serves as a Vocal Artist and Assistant Artistic Director at the Istanbul Meydan Meşkleri Ensemble of the Ministry of Culture and Tourism.
